10 minute time lapse of Santi shi (three body posture). Santi Shi is the foundation of Xingyi Quan (form-intention fist). One stands 70 percent waited on back foot and 30 percent on front, bending the knees to sink down into the hips and tuck the tailbone as to straighten the spine. The torso is upright as well as the high point of the head lifted by slightly tucking the chin. Chest is slightly sunken to promote breathing down to the the lower abdominal region and create a rounded structure/connection from the back to the arms as well as many other details. In internal martial arts we often meditate and work out at the same time and use this posture to improve internal structure while clearing and focusing the mind’s intention for practice.
